My journey into design patterns had a different starting point than Alan's but we have reached the same conclusions:
Pattern-based analyses make you a more effective and efficient analyst because they let you deal with your models more abstractly and because they represent the collected experiences of many other analysts.
Patterns help people to learn principles of object orientation. The patterns help to explain why we do what we do with objects.
